Trifluoropropyl Dimethicone/PEG-10 Crosspolymer
INCI: TRIFLUOROPROPYL DIMETHICONE/PEG-10 CROSSPOLYMER
A silicone polymer that helps products stay put and resist water, but may feel heavy on some skin types.
In plain English
This is a synthetic silicone ingredient that forms a flexible, breathable film on the skin. It helps sunscreen and makeup stay in place longer, especially when you sweat or go swimming. Think of it like a very thin, invisible raincoat for your skin — it doesn't clog pores for most people, but it can feel a bit slick or heavy if you have very oily skin.

What it is
A crosslinked silicone polymer that combines trifluoropropyl groups (which repel water and oil) with PEG-10 (a water-friendly chain). This structure creates a flexible film that adheres to skin and resists wash-off.
How it works
When applied, the polymer spreads into a thin, even layer that dries down to a flexible film. The trifluoropropyl part repels water and oil, while the PEG-10 part helps the ingredient mix with other formula components. The crosslinked structure keeps the film from cracking or flaking, improving wear time and water resistance.
Pros
Boosts water resistance
Helps sunscreen and makeup stay effective even when you sweat or swim, so you don't have to reapply as often.
Smooth application
Spreads easily and evenly, reducing patchiness and making products feel silky on the skin.
Cons and cautions
Can feel heavy on oily skin
The silicone film may feel slick or greasy if you have very oily skin, potentially contributing to a shiny look.
Environmental persistence
Like many silicones, this ingredient is not readily biodegradable and can accumulate in waterways, raising eco-concerns.

Safety summary
Generally recognized as safe for topical use at typical concentrations. Low irritation and comedogenic risk. No significant safety concerns have been reported in cosmetic use.
Research notes
Limited peer-reviewed studies on this specific polymer, but silicone crosspolymers as a class are well-studied for safety and efficacy in cosmetics. The trifluoropropyl group adds water and oil repellency without increasing toxicity.
Common label clues
- Typical concentration
- 1–10%
- Regulatory status
- Approved for use in cosmetics in the US (FDA), EU (CosIng), and many other regions. No specific concentration limits are set, but typical use levels are low.
- Common uses
- Sunscreens, Long-wear foundations, Water-resistant makeup, Primers
- Environmental note
- Silicone-based polymers like this one are not biodegradable and may accumulate in the environment. Some brands are moving toward more eco-friendly alternatives.
Good to know
- This ingredient is often found in 'water-resistant' or 'sweatproof' sunscreens and long-wear foundations.
- It is considered safe for use in cosmetics by major regulatory bodies, but its environmental impact is a growing concern.
